NASA's Nancy Grace Roman Space Telescope was successfully launched on 30 August after funding struggles and a name change. It will now make a three-month, one-million-mile journey to its orbit at the second Sun-Earth Lagrange point (L2) beyond the Moon, where it will survey the universe about 1,000 times faster than Hubble using a wide-field infrared camera.
Roman is equipped with a coronagraph system that blocks and masks glare from stars, allowing it to directly image exoplanets including smaller, older and colder planets orbiting close to their stars. It will also conduct detailed 3D scans to map the distribution of dark matter and, using gravitational lensing, study how dark energy has shaped the evolution of the universe. NASA's Nicky Fox called the telescope 'a discovery machine' that will bring humanity closer to answering its most profound questions about cosmic history.
The launch marks the start of a flagship NASA mission expected to transform our understanding of dark matter, dark energy and exoplanets - the biggest open questions in cosmology. For anyone interested in science, this is a generational space event.
